Merge pull request #5207 from Ka0o0/fix-resolvd-host-network

fix: check network mode when choosing resolv.conf

var resolvconfPath = func(netMode pb.NetMode) string {
// The implementation of resolvconf.Path checks if systemd resolved is activated and chooses the internal
// resolv.conf (/run/systemd/resolve/resolv.conf) in such a case - see resolvconf_path.go of libnetwork.
// This, however, can be problematic, see https://github.com/moby/buildkit/issues/2404 and is not necessary
// in case the networking mode is set to host since the locally (127.0.0.53) running resolved daemon is
// accessible from inside a host networked container.
// For details of the implementation see https://github.com/moby/buildkit/pull/5207#discussion_r1705362230.
if netMode == pb.NetMode_HOST {
return "/etc/resolv.conf"
}
return resolvconf.Path()
}
